Spark Plugs

#1 Post by FalcoJock » Tue Feb 09, 2010 7:52 pm

Which iridium spark plugs are best for the Falco? I've found Denso Iridium Power Spark Plug IXU27. Is that the right one?

Cheers.

#5 Post by paganman » Wed Feb 10, 2010 12:17 pm

The big question is - which one is better? Is there any difference?
I fitted some iridium plugs to my VFR over a year ago, and to be honest noticed bugger-all difference over new, standard plugs.
Apparently they don't need changing as often though, so should save money in the long run. Which is important if you're from Yorkshire.
